Mount & Blade 2: Bannerlordis the latest in a series ofaction-adventure games with strategy elementsabout leading an army into battle and expanding one’s control of the territory. That said, the series is probably most known for its modding scene, and in particular for the total conversion mods that bring the games out of their faux-medieval setting and into a completely different genre.

Somefamous total conversion modsfor the oldMount & Blade: WarbandincludeWarsword Conquest, based onWarhammer Fantasy(which still receives the occasional update), andL’Aigle, a Napoleonic Wars most known for its massive online battles. WhileMount & Blade 2: Bannerlorddoesn’t have quite as many total conversion mods, it’s worth remembering that this is a relatively new game, and modders don’t like redoing much of their work every time the game receives an update.

7Eagle Rising - Dawn of an Empire

Ancient Roman Faction And Other Empires

Eagle Risingis a total conversion mod that brings factions from the classical era to Calradia, the fictional setting ofMount & Blade. Alternatively, though this can make the mod more finicky, players can use the popularMount & Blade 2: BannerlordmodLemmy’s Europe Mapfor amore grounded setting.

The new factions ofEagle Risinginclude the Roman Empire, the Dacians, The Scythian Kingdom, the Celts, Carthage, and a vague Germanic faction. That said, historical accuracy definitely takes a backseat to the fun factor inEagle Rising. But that’s not always bad: some of the most beloved video games with historical settings, like classic strategy seriesCivilizationandAge of Empires, have a similar approach.

6Realm Of Thrones

Game Of Thrones Characters, Factions, And Dragons

Realm of Thrones, as the name implies,is the mod that brings the world of Westeros intoMount & Blade 2: Bannerlord. Unlike similar mods,Realm of Thronesdoesn’t just add factions and recognizable characters but actually changes the world. This mod comes packaged with a massive map of Westeros and the nearby continent.

Perhaps the most impressive achievement ofRealm of Thronesis its functioning dragons. Granted, they don’t always look entirely functional. Flight, in particular, seems to be an issue as the beasts flap their wings at the speed of a hummingbird; they fly so low that their arms keep touching the ground. But a dragon is a dragon, nonetheless. Weird movements aside, it certainly adds a lot to the game.

5The Land Of Sika

Original Fantasy Setting With A New Campaign

Being the work of fans, total conversion mods tend to be about things those fans love, be it an existing book series, another video game, or a time period. That’s certainly the case forMount & Blade 2: Bannerlord, with its Roman Empire andStar Warstotal conversions.The Land of Sika, an original setting with unique factions, a new map, and a dedicated storyline, is one of the very few exceptions.

The Land of Sikais a fantasy hero story, and the focus of the game shifts to represent this change. The world is now populated with special sites the player must visit to learn more about the world. There are dungeons where only the player character is allowed. There is even a crafting system, clearly inspired by recent trends insingle-player action RPGs.

3Realms Forgotten

Original Fantasy Setting World Map And Factions

Realms Forgottenis the second most popular total conversion mod forMount & Blade 2: Bannerlord, with an original setting and world. It currently features seven new factions, each equipped with a unique advantage in combat. And since it’s a fantasy setting with quite a bit of lore behind it, the mod comes with a new world.

Realms Forgottenalso comes with anexpanded character creation menu, customized to reflect the inhabitants of the new setting. And since this mod is set in a fantasy world, players can look forward to acquiring magical items, fighting special encounters against roaming monsters, and recruiting legendary heroes into their army.

2The Old Realms

Warhammer Fantasy World Map, Factions, And Magic

The Old Realmsis a total conversion mod that attempts to bring the world of Games Workshop’sWarhammer FantasytoMount & Blade 2: Bannerlord. While the developers of this mod describe their work as early access, the project is well on its way to becoming the most feature-filled total conversion mod for the game.

At the time of writing, the current build, Knights and Saints, includes a custom-made campaign map, many Empire factions, the Vampire Courts, magic that can be used in combat, and a partial implementation of artillery. The team plans to add more factions, expand the world map, and fill the mod withiconic characters fromWarhammer Fantasy.

1Napoleonic Warfare Open-Source

Muskets And Factions From The Napoleonic Wars

Napoleonic Warfare Open-Sourceisn’t quite as developed as other total conversion mods. However, it should still be mentioned because of the popularity of mods set during the Napoleonic Wars for olderMount & Bladegames, especiallyL’AigleforMount & Blade: Warband.

WhileNapoleonic Warfare Open-Sourceisn’t quite ready for a full campaign and doesn’t plan on adding a multiplayer mode, its open-source nature means that implementing those changes is in the hands of other modders. Meanwhile,Sword & Musketis a similar upcoming mod forMount & Blade 2: Bannerlordwith a focus on multiplayer, but playing it is quite a bit harder, as it is only available on specific servers during specific hours.
